Title: Patient/Guest Wi Fi Maintenance and Support Services VA Maryland Health Care System (VAMHCS) Purpose This is a Pre Solicitation Notice issued in accordance with FAR Part 5. This is not a solicitation. A formal Request for Quotation (RFQ) will be posted to SAM.gov under the solicitation number listed above. Requirement Overview The Department of Veterans Affairs intends to issue a solicitation for short term maintenance and support of the existing Patient/Guest Wi Fi network at the following VAMHCS locations: Baltimore VA Medical Center 10 North Greene Street, Baltimore, MD Loch Raven VA Medical Center 3900 Loch Raven Blvd., Baltimore, MD Perry Point VA Medical Center 361 Boiler House Road, Perryville, MD The Contractor will provide full lifecycle operational support (maintenance, remote administration, monitoring, outage response, dedicated bandwidth management, incident reporting, and configuration sustainment) for the currently installed Wi Fi infrastructure. Set Aside Determination Based on market research, the Government intends to solicit this requirement as a 100% Service Disabled Veteran Owned Small Business (SDVOSB) Set Aside in accordance with the Veterans First Contracting Program (38 U.S.C. § 8127). Only firms verified as SDVOSB in the SBA Veteran Small Business Certification (VetCert) system at the time of quote submission and at the time of award will be eligible to compete. Anticipated Solicitation Release The Government anticipates posting the solicitation on SAM.gov on or about: September 2026 Quotes will be required to be submitted electronically as specified in the forthcoming RFQ.
